What is Massage Therapy?
Massage therapy is a manual therapy that involves the manipulation of soft tissues in the body, including muscles, tendons, ligaments, and connective tissue. The goal of massage therapy is to promote relaxation, reduce pain and tension, and improve overall health and well-being.
There are several types of massage therapy, each with its own unique techniques and benefits:
What Is A Swedish massage?
Swedish massage is a gentle form of massage that uses long, flowing strokes to promote relaxation and ease muscle tension.
What Is A Deep tissue massage?
Deep tissue massage is a more intense form of massage that targets the deeper layers of muscle tissue to release chronic tension and pain.
What Is A Sports massage?
Sports massage is designed to help athletes prepare for and recover from physical activity, reducing the risk of injury and improving performance.
What Is Trigger point massage?
Trigger point massage focuses on specific areas of tension and pain in the body, using targeted pressure to release knots and alleviate discomfort.
What Are The Benefits of Massage Therapy?
Massage therapy offers a wide range of benefits for both physical and mental health. Some of the most notable benefits include:
- Pain relief
- Improved circulation
- Reduced muscle tension
- Stress reduction
- Better sleep
- Increased flexibility
According to a survey by the American Massage Therapy Association, 88% of respondents agreed that massage can be effective in reducing pain, and 79% believed that massage can be beneficial for health and wellness.
Combining Massage Therapy with Chiropractic Care
Massage therapy and chiropractic care are natural partners in promoting optimal health and wellness. While chiropractic care focuses on the alignment and function of the spine and other joints, massage therapy addresses the soft tissues that support and surround those joints.
By combining massage therapy with chiropractic treatments, patients can experience a range of benefits, including:
Faster recovery from injuries
Massage therapy can help to reduce inflammation and promote healing in injured tissues, while chiropractic care can help to restore proper alignment and function to the affected area.
Enhanced pain relief
Massage therapy and chiropractic care work together to address both the symptoms and the underlying causes of pain, providing more comprehensive and effective relief.
Improved overall wellness
Regular massage therapy and chiropractic care can help to maintain optimal health and prevent future injuries and illnesses.

Massage Therapy After a Car Accident
Massage therapy can be particularly beneficial for individuals who have been involved in a car accident. Common injuries such as whiplash, neck pain, and back pain can be effectively treated with massage therapy, helping to reduce pain and promote healing.
If you’ve been in a car accident, it’s important to seek medical attention as soon as possible, even if you don’t feel injured. Some injuries, such as whiplash, may not be immediately apparent, but can cause long-term pain and disability if left untreated.

Top Statistics and Expert Insights
Research has consistently shown the effectiveness of massage therapy for a range of health conditions. For example:
- A study published in the Annals of Internal Medicine found that massage therapy was effective in reducing chronic neck pain, with benefits lasting up to 12 weeks after treatment.
- Another study published in the Journal of Alternative and Complementary Medicine found that massage therapy was effective in reducing symptoms of depression and anxiety, with benefits comparable to those of psychotherapy.
Practical Advice for Getting the Most Out of Massage Therapy
If you’re considering massage therapy as part of your chiropractic care plan, here are some practical tips to help you get the most out of your sessions:
- How often should you get a massage? The frequency of your massage therapy sessions will depend on your individual needs and goals. For acute pain or injury, more frequent sessions may be recommended, while maintenance sessions may be scheduled less often.
- What to expect during a massage therapy session: During a massage therapy session, you’ll lie on a comfortable massage table, either fully or partially undressed, depending on your comfort level. Your massage therapist will use a variety of techniques to address your specific needs, which may include long, flowing strokes, targeted pressure, and stretching.
- Tips for communicating with your massage therapist: It’s important to communicate openly and honestly with your massage therapist about your goals, preferences, and any areas of discomfort or pain. Your therapist should be responsive to your feedback and adjust their techniques accordingly.
- Aftercare advice for prolonging the benefits of massage therapy: After your massage therapy session, be sure to drink plenty of water to help flush out toxins and stay hydrated. You may also want to take it easy for the rest of the day, avoiding strenuous activity or heavy lifting. Consistent self-care practices, such as stretching and exercise, can also help to prolong the benefits of massage therapy between sessions.
